Employment Law Class Action Cases Again Lead California Weekly Filings

To aid California class action defense attorneys in anticipating claims against which they may have to defend, we provide weekly, unofficial summaries of the legal categories for class actions filed in California state and federal courts in the Los Angeles, San Francisco, San Jose, Sacramento, San Diego, San Mateo, Oakland/Alameda and Orange County areas. Employment law cases once again head up the list. This report covers the time period from July 28 – August 3, 2006. We include only those categories that include 10% or more of the class action filings during the relevant timeframe. Approximately 35 class action lawsuits were filed in these California state and federal courts during that time period, of which 10 involved employment law claims (29%). The second place category consists of five (5) new antitrust class action filings (14%), all of which involve the British Airways case. The third group consists of four (4) securities laws class actions (11%).
